Fellow Content Participant definition

Fellow Content Participant means Content Participant and any other provider of Commercial Entertainment Content that has entered into a Content Participant Agreement.
Fellow Content Participant means any entity (including Content Participant), which has executed a Content Participant Agreement that remains in effect with AACS LA and Licensors in order to use and implement any Specification and AACS Technology licensed pursuant to such Content Participant Agreement and shall include its Affiliates.
